Shrnutí:A 2 N dead-weight type force standard machine (DWM) had been developed at the National Metrology Institute of Japan (NMIJ). Modifications of the force transducers and weight receivers of the DWM improved measurement reproducibility with rotational position change. Two modified small-capacity force transducers with rated capacities of 1 and 2 N could be precisely calibrated according to International Organization for Standardization (ISO) 376. The results showed quite smaller uncertainties in the calibration ranges of 100 mN to 1 N and 200 mN to 2 N than the catalogue accuracies of commercial transducers. The validity of the calibration capability of the 2 N DWM was confirmed by comparing it with a 50 N DWM. The results obtained by two DWMs coincided within the uncertainties of calibration.
